Unit Clerk – NICU Jobs in Edmonton at Alberta Health Services
Your Opportunity:
The Stollery Philip C. Etches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) located at the Royal Alexandra Hospital, is a 69 funded bed unit that accepts babies from all over Northern Alberta, Yukon, Northwest Territories, and Nunavut, and is characterized by high acuity and high activity. Reporting to the Unit Manager, the Unit Clerk functions as a receptionist and clerk for the NICU. The position is a coordinator and central source of information and records relating to the activities, communication, and services of the patients and families in the NICU. As a Unit Clerk, you will be responsible for the efficient flow of communication between health professionals, departments, patients and families while maintaining confidentiality of patient information. You will be responsible for a variety of administrative tasks including reception, managing the telephones, greeting and directing visitors, patients and allied health professionals, and managing patient records and charts. The position is also responsible for relaying information related to admissions, transfers and discharge of patients, diagnostic tests, booking appointments and consults. The incumbent will ensure an adequate level of supplies and equipment are available on the unit for use by the inter-professional team. You will also be responsible for performing a range of administrative activities in support of the unit. The Unit Clerk fulfills the expectations of the role within the framework of AHS values and Patient and Family Centre Care, acting and communicating with care, compassion, and empathy.
